Austin runs on breakfast tacos. The city has elevated the morning taco to an art form, but don't sleep on the authentic Mexican taquerias and late-night taco trucks scattered across town.

Legendary Breakfast Tacos

Veracruz All Natural

$ • Multiple Locations

The migas taco is legendary. Started from a trailer, now an institution.

Tacodeli

$ • Multiple Locations

The Otto is iconic—potatoes, egg, cheese, bacon, and their famous doña sauce.

Joe's Bakery

$ • East Austin

Old-school Tex-Mex. Been serving East Austin since 1962.

Street-Style & Authentic

Cuantos Tacos

$ • East Austin

Mexico City-style tacos. Suadero and al pastor from a tiny trailer.

Taqueria Mi Trailita

$ • East Austin

Authentic as it gets. Cash only, limited hours, worth the trip.

Rosita's Al Pastor

$ • South Austin

The rotating trompo is legit. Late-night essential.

Upscale & Creative

Suerte

$$$ • East Austin

Modern Mexican with masa made in-house. Tasting menu is outstanding.

Comedor

$$$ • Downtown

Interior Mexican cuisine elevated. Beautiful space, refined tacos.

Nixta Taqueria

$$ • East Austin

Creative fillings on handmade blue corn tortillas. Chef-driven tacos.

Pro Tip: Breakfast tacos are an all-day affair in Austin. Most spots serve them until at least 2pm. Get there before 9am on weekends to avoid lines.
